In the 1960s, Mary Quant’s mini-skirt started a fashion revolution. This exhibition has many of the designer’s most iconic creations that made Britain swing. 2 for 1 entry with your Eurostar ticket.
On Christmas Day, some Londoners take off their festive sweaters and jump in icy water. Take the plunge at Hampton Pool or Hampstead Heath, or watch the Serpentine Swimming Club race in Hyde Park.
